Kerala: Cooperative bank fraud; ED confiscates Moideen’s property worth Rs 15 crore

Kerala CPM and its senior leader A C Moideen faces further heat in connection with Rs 150 cr Karuvannur bank fraud in Thrissur district. The latest report suggest that benami (proxy) properties worth Rs 15 cr, allegedly connected to Moideen, including 36 properties and other assets have been confiscated by ED

The confiscation of Moideen’s properties comes close on the heels of the continuous  Enforcement Directorate (ED) raids at the former minister’s house which took more than 22 hours on August 23. According to reports, the confiscation is in view of the ED’s findings of Moideen’s involvement in the bank fraud.

ED had recently frozen the bank accounts of Moideen. Accounts in the names of Moideedn and his wife have been frozen on the basis of two orders. They are of bank deposits and fixed deposits worth Rs 28 lakhs.

Also, bank accounts of another three individuals have also been frozen. Those bank account holders are alleged to be Moideen’s benamies. The allegations against Moideen, in this regard, have been in the air since long.

Moideen had said that the ED aimed at making him an accused and put him in the web of suspicion and keeps on hounding him. He had added that the raid at his home was based on some one’s statement that he had helped somebody to avail a loan, of course, off the straight forward track. He had said, he was ready to cooperate with any investigation since he had nothing to fear or hide.

Now, CPM leaders maintain that the whole affair is frivolous. They allege that the Union government, led by BJP, misuses ED and IT department for political vendetta. They say that Moideen is a thorough gentleman and his life is transparent.  But, when asked about the involvement of CPM leaders and men, they flaunt a readymade answer – “We have expelled them from the party positions”.
